Peanut Butter Banana Brownies

Ingredients

  • 2 bananas

  • 1 cup peanut butter

  • ½ cup coconut sugar

  • ¼ cup oat flour

  • 3 tablespoons warm water

  • 1 tablespoon ground flaxseed

  • 1 cup vegan chocolate chips (I use Enjoy Life Mini Chips)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ees and spray the baking dish with cooking spray.

  2. Mix in a small bowl the flaxseed and warm water then set it aside for about 10 minutes.

  3. Mash 2 bananas in a large bowl then add the peanut butter, coconut sugar, oat flour and mix.

  4. Add the flaxseed and water mixture to the big bowl then mix everything together.

  5. Fold in the vegan chocolate chips.

  6. Optional: Slice a banana in half and then slice the half in half. Add the 2 thinner slices to the top.

  7. Bake in the oven for about 30 minutes then keep checking on it until desired consistency. This is a vegan dessert, so you don’t have to worry about over or under cooking. I took it out at about 30 minutes and it was ooey gooey — just the way I like it!

Serving: 9 brownies
